Canadian Women's Foundation breaks campaign

The Canadian Women’s Foundation has begun a campaign timed to coincide with Mother’s Day called “The Mother Rising.” Developed by recently-launched Toronto agency Hard Work Club, the campaign consists of a 90-second video depicting a series of mothers, expectant mothers and children, accompanied by a voiceover advocating for “justice and equality” for mothers. The campaign also includes online pre-roll video ads, influencer activities and social media content.

“There’s never been a more important time to focus on diverse mothers and family caregivers in Canada,” said Andrea Gunraj, vice-president of public engagement at the foundation. “The COVID-19 pandemic’s impact on them has been dire, especially for those facing multiple barriers such as racism, poverty and gender-based violence. This campaign opens space for them to tell their stories without judgement, to be angry and frustrated at the ways they’re expected to hold it together with such little support, and share what systemic changes need to happen so they can have a better future.”
